True Alchemy


The contrast between a wax model and the same piece after it has been reborn in metal is always remarkable. Some of the qualities us in the wax which seduced us as maker are forever lost except in memory: the soft luminous quality wax has under lights, its delicateness and minuscule weight.


These qualities are replaced by the more robust qualities of the metal. The weight increases by at least a factor of 10. It becomes durable and hard, reflecting the light back at its source and away from its self rather than letting light permeate its form.


The preciousness of the ephemeral is replaced by the value in the enduring.
